Webb19 maj 2024 · Before the K to 12 program was implemented in the Philippine Education System, primary and secondary education in the Philippines used to entail only 10 years of schooling, of which the first six years covered elementary school and the last four years covered high school. K–12 education in the Philippines covers kindergarten and 12 years of basic education to provide sufficient time for mastery of concepts and skills, develop lifelong learners, and prepare graduates for tertiary education, middle-level skills development, employment, and entrepreneurship. Webb13 juni 2024 · Basic education in the Philippines before K to 12 consists of 6 years of elementary education and 4 years of high school education. One of the benefits of K-12 curriculum is designed to enable graduates to join the workhorse right after high school, and suitably prefer those who want to go on to higher education. Unlike the old system, K-12 does not compel each student to take college after completing Senior High School (SHS).
